Philippines may ground flights over jet fuel shortage from global conflict, prompting flight cuts and surcharges.
The Philippines may ground flights due to a jet fuel shortage linked to the U.S.-Israel-Iran conflict, President Ferdinand Marcos Jr. said, as several countries barred refueling, forcing airlines to carry extra fuel and cut payloads.
Regional carriers, including Cebu Air and Vietnam Airlines, are cutting flights and preparing fuel surcharges.
While the government says airlines have sufficient fuel orders, rising global energy costs and supply disruptions are straining air travel across Asia.
